About Whatcom Museum
The Whatcom Museum housed in the Old City Hall, Lightcatcher building and Syre Education Center was initially worked in 1892 as the city corridor for the previous town of New Whatcom, before it was joined with encompassing towns to shape Bellingham, Washington. The building was composed in a Late Victorian style by Alfred Lee, a neighborhood planner, who utilized red block and Chuckanut Sandstone for its construction. The outline itself was a relatively correct copy of the second Saginaw County Courthouse in Saginaw, Michigan, Designed by Fred W. Hollister.
At the season of development, the building was arranged on a feign above Bellingham Bay. In any case, finished the years, noteworthy measures of the waterfront were filled in to make more land. As of now, the building sits above Maritime Heritage Park. The building filled in as city corridor until 1936, and turned out to be a piece of the historical center in 1941. In 1962, the fire harmed the building, yet endeavors from the network fund-raised to reestablish the building. In 2009, The Whatcom Museum opened an area in the recently planned Lightcatcher building. The Lightcatcher, planned via Seattle-based Olson Kundig Architects, is named for its 37 feet high and 180 feet long translucent divider, which encourages ious vitality sparing systems.
